The Future of In Vitro Fertilization Market Looks Promising in Healthcare Industry

The major factors driving the growth of the market are the increasing number of infertility cases, rising awareness about IVF treatment, and growing number of IVF clinics.

With the increasing number of infertility cases, the demand for IVF treatment is also increasing. Infertility is caused due to various reasons such as PCOS, endometriosis, uterine fibroids, etc. According to WHO, around 48.5 million women worldwide suffer from infertility. IVF is one of the most effective treatments for infertility and has helped many couples become parents.

The awareness about IVF treatment is also increasing among couples struggling with infertility. With the help of social media and the internet, couples are able to learn about this treatment option and its success rate. In addition, there are a growing number of IVF clinics which are providing this treatment to couples.

As the world population continues to grow, the demand for in vitro fertilization (IVF) services is expected to rise. The market for IVF is expected to reach $987 Million by 2026, according to a report by MarketsandMarkets.

The report cites several factors that will contribute to the growth of the IVF market, including an increase in the number of women delaying motherhood, the rising prevalence of infertility, and the availability of more advanced IVF technology.

With more couples turning to IVF to conceive, the market is expected to become more competitive. IVF providers will need to offer innovative and affordable services to attract and retain customers. 

IVF is a popular fertility treatment for couples who are struggling to conceive. There are many reasons why people may opt for IVF, including advanced maternal age, blocked fallopian tubes, endometriosis, male factor infertility, and unexplained infertility.

IVF offers couples who are struggling to conceive a chance to have a baby. The success rates of IVF have improved over the years, and the procedure is now more affordable than ever before. The prominent players operating in the global in vitro fertilization market include The Cooper Companies Inc. (US), Cook Group (US), Vitrolife (Sweden), Thermo Fisher Scientific, Inc. (US), Esco Micro Pte. Ltd. (Singapore), Genea Limited (Australia), IVFtech ApS (Denmark), FUJIFILM Irvine Scientific (US), The Baker Company, Inc. (US), Kitazato Corporation (Japan), Corning Corporation (US), Hamilton Thorne Ltd. (US), ZEISS Group (Germany), FERTIPRO NV(Belgium), and Eppendorf (Germany).
